Lost at Christmas (I) (2020)
6/10
Pretty good except for the ending...

I really enjoyed the majority of this movie. The ending implies that they probably don't end up together for good, which is not the kind of thing I am looking for in a Christmas romance. Maybe that's more realistic but it's not like the rest of the film was committed to realism so I'm not sure what the filmmakers were trying to accomplish there. I liked the other 99% of it enough to watch it again, but I'll certainly be trimming the end off of my next viewing experience. If you think you'll probably feel the same way about it that I do, then I would stop the movie after she sings her song and they kiss. Perfect ending.

The score killed the vibe a little. It could have used something a little more upbeat. This movie definitely has dramatic moments, it's as much a drama as a comedy, I would say, but some jollier music would have gone a long way in improving my enjoyment.

Otherwise, a cute film with a good romance and a nice change of pace from the Hallmark and Lifetime movies while still being generally the same type of movie.
